What Exactly Are Non Gamstop Casinos?

Non Gamstop casinos are online gambling sites not registered with the UK’s self-exclusion scheme. They hold licenses from other respected regulators-like the Malta Gaming Authority or Curacao eGaming. This means they don’t have to follow Gamstop’s strict deposit limits or cooling-off periods. What You Risk

  1. Less consumer protection: UKGC’s dispute resolution and chargeback rights don’t apply.
  2. Self-exclusion gaps: If you’re on Gamstop, these sites won’t block you automatically-you have to manage it yourself.
  3. Currency conversion fees: Many operate in euros or dollars, so your bank might take a cut.

Payment Methods That Actually Work

Non Gamstop casinos lean heavily on alternative payments. C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um are king-they offer near-instant deposits and withdrawals, plus anonymity. Digital wallets (Skrill, Neteller) are common but watch for fees. Bank transfers still exist but take 3-5 days.
